The Regional Intervention Program
has launched a new program to assist parents in dealing with
behavior issues. Families of children younger than six
years old can attend two – two hour sessions a week over six
to eight month to learn parenting techniques. The program
is free and adults repay RIP by volunteering to train and
support new families. For more information, contact
